Is Louis Vuitton Leather or Vinyl?
The simple answer is: both, and neither exclusively. To understand this, we must move beyond the simplistic categorization. Louis Vuitton employs a diverse range of materials, carefully selected for their durability, aesthetic qualities, and suitability for specific product lines. While some coveted pieces utilize high-quality, supple leather, often sourced from prestigious tanneries, many others feature the brand's iconic coated canvas, a blend of cotton and PVC (polyvinyl chloride), which is often mistakenly referred to as vinyl. This coated canvas offers a unique combination of durability, water resistance, and the distinct Louis Vuitton monogram. The presence of PVC does not diminish the quality or prestige of these items; rather, it contributes to their practicality and longevity.
Furthermore, the term "leather vinyl" itself is somewhat misleading. It suggests a direct blend of leather and vinyl, which is not typically the case with Louis Vuitton products. Instead, "leather vinyl" is often used colloquially to describe leather-like materials, or to refer to the coated canvas that has a somewhat vinyl-like finish. True vinyl, a purely synthetic material, is rarely used in the creation of high-end Louis Vuitton bags. The brand primarily utilizes high-quality leather, coated canvas, and other carefully selected materials to achieve the desired look and feel of each piece.
Louis Vuitton Leather Fabric Range for Sale by the Yard in 2024
Officially, Louis Vuitton does not offer its leather or coated canvas for sale by the yard to the general public. The brand meticulously controls its materials and manufacturing processes to maintain quality control and exclusivity. While some high-end fabric suppliers might offer materials with similar textures and patterns, these will not be genuine Louis Vuitton fabrics. Attempts to purchase "Louis Vuitton leather by the yard" from unofficial sources should be approached with extreme caution, as these are likely counterfeit products.
What are Louis Vuitton Bags Made From? (All Revealed)
The range of materials employed by Louis Vuitton is surprisingly extensive. Beyond the iconic monogrammed canvas and leather, the brand utilizes:
* Genuine Leather: Various types of leather, including calfskin, lambskin, and exotic skins (subject to ethical sourcing concerns and regulations), are used in many of their luxury handbags, wallets, and other accessories. The quality and type of leather directly influence the price and feel of the finished product.
* Coated Canvas: The most recognizable material, this durable canvas is coated with a protective layer, typically PVC, to enhance its water resistance and longevity. This is where the "vinyl" misconception often arises.
* Textiles: Louis Vuitton incorporates various textiles, including silk, linen, and other high-quality fabrics, often in lining or as accent materials in their designs.
